What’s the best beef to use?

I like to use flank steak for this recipe as it doesn’t require a long marinade time and it’s super quick to cook. Skirt steak would also work well. If you have thicker steaks, like sirloin, you can pound them thin before cutting and marinading.

Can you add other veggies?

Yes, it’s super easy to add additional veggies to this recipe. Feel free to add in some diced bell pepper or julienne carrots for additional texture and flavor. Just add them to the skillet to the same time as the broccoli.

What do you serve it with?

This Mongolian beef and broccoli is great to serve over rice, Jasmine and Basmati both work well. I like to garnish it with some sesame seeds too, and add some sliced scallions for some freshness and color.

Tips!

  • Make this recipe gluten-free by using tamari instead of soy sauce.
  • Allow one hour to marinate the beef. It can be done in half and hour but will have slightly less flavor. It can be marinated for up to 4 hours.
  • Leftovers will keep well for up to 4 days and can be reheated in the skillet to serve.

Ingredients

  • 1 pound flank steak cut into ¼-inch strips
  • ¼ cup plus 1 tablespoon cooking oil divided
  • ¼ cup plus 2 teaspoons low-sodium soy sauce divided
  • 5 tablespoons cornstarch divided
  • 3 cloves garlic finely chopped
  • 2 teaspoons fresh ginger
  • cup water
  • 2 tablespoons brown sugar
  • 2 tablespoons hoisin sauce
  • 1 head broccoli cut into florets
  • 2 scallions cut into 1-inch pieces
  • Sesame seeds for garnish
  • Cooked jasmine rice for serving

Instructions

  • In a plastic zipper bag, combine the steak with 1 tablespoon oil, 2 teaspoons soy sauce, and 2 tablespoons cornstarch.

    1 pound flank steak, ¼ cup plus 1 tablespoon cooking oil, ¼ cup plus 2 teaspoons low-sodium soy sauce, 5 tablespoons cornstarch

    Mongolian Beef and Broccoli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(13)

  • Seal the bag and marinate in the refrigerator for 1 hour.

    Mongolian Beef and Broccoli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(14)

  • In a large skillet over medium-high heat, heat the remaining oil. Dredge the beef through the remaining cornstarch, shaking off any excess. Saute beef in batches until crispy, about 2 minutes per side, then transfer to a paper towel-lined plate.

    1 pound flank steak

    Mongolian Beef and Broccoli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(15)

  • Add garlic and ginger and cook until fragrant, 1 minute. Stir in remaining soy sauce, water, brown sugar, and hoisin sauce. Bring the mixture to a simmer and allow it to thicken, 4 to 5 minutes.

    ¼ cup plus 2 teaspoons low-sodium soy sauce, 3 cloves garlic, 2 teaspoons fresh ginger, ⅓ cup water, 2 tablespoons brown sugar, 2 tablespoons hoisin sauce

    Mongolian Beef and Broccoli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(16)

  • Stir in broccoli, cover, and cook until tender, about 3 minutes.

    1 head broccoli, 2 scallions

    Mongolian Beef and Broccoli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(17)

  • Add the scallions and return the beef to the skillet and stir until completely coated in sauce.

    Mongolian Beef and Broccoli Recipe - The Cookie Rookie® (18)

  • Serve over rice, garnished with sesame seeds.

    Cooked jasmine rice, Sesame seeds
